Myth 1: “Pod Coffee Machines Only Produce Weak, Watery Coffee”
One of the most persistent myths plaguing capsule coffee systems is that they cannot extract enough flavor, resulting in a thin, watery brew reminiscent of hotel room drip coffee. Critics often argue that physical limitations prevent pods from holding enough grounds to make a robust mug.
The Reality: The Nespresso Vertuo Pop+ Deluxe completely shatters this assumption through its proprietary Centrifusion™ technology. Unlike traditional espresso machines that rely solely on high-pressure pumps, or standard pod systems that use gravity trickling, this centrifugal machine spins the capsule at up to 7,000 rotations per minute. This centrifugal force blends ground coffee with water thoroughly, extracting rich flavor notes and creating a luxurious, thick layer of natural crema on top of your cup. Whether you are pouring a standard 1.35 oz espresso shot, a 5 oz Gran Lungo, or a full 7.77 oz Mug, the flavor profile remains dense, aromatic, and deeply satisfying.
Key Features of the Nespresso Vertuo Pop+ Deluxe
To truly understand why this machine disrupts standard coffee expectations, we need to inspect its core engineering and specifications:
- Centrifusion™ Extraction Technology: Patented system that reads barcode technology on each capsule to automatically adjust brewing parameters—temperature, rotation speed, infusion time, and cup volume.
- Versatile Cup Sizes: Accommodates four distinct cup sizes, ranging from concentrated Espresso (1.35 oz) and Double Espresso (2.7 oz) to Gran Lungo (5 oz) and large Mug/Coffee (7.77 oz).
- Compact & Vibrant Design: Crafted with a sleek, minimalist footprint in a sophisticated Titan finish that easily fits cramped countertops, college dorms, or sleek modern office spaces.
- One-Touch Operation: A simple single-button interface initiates the entire brewing cycle, eliminating guesswork and calibration.
- Adjustable & Removable Water Tank: Features a flexible 25-ounce water reservoir that can be repositioned to suit your kitchen counter layout.
- Smart Connectivity: Bluetooth and Wi-Fi capability ensure your machine stays updated with the latest software and maintenance alerts.

Performance Breakdown: Speed, Taste, and Usability
How does the machine actually perform during a chaotic morning rush? In terms of speed, the Vertuo Pop+ Deluxe heats up in roughly 30 seconds. Once warmed up, dropping a capsule, closing the lever, and pressing the button initiates a completely automated extraction sequence.
The barcode printed on the rim of every Nespresso Vertuo pod tells the machine precisely how to brew that specific blend. Light roast blends, dark roasts, flavored coffees, and decaf options are treated with customized water temperatures and extraction durations. The result in the cup is consistently hot, aromatic, and crowned with a thick hazelnut-colored foam layer that holds sugar and creamer effortlessly.
Noise level is another metric where this machine surprises skeptics. While centrifugal spinning inherently generates sound, Breville has sound-dampened the internal housing, making it much quieter than traditional commercial grinders or older pod units.
Myth 3: “Cleaning and Maintaining Capsule Machines is a Nightmare”
Many home baristas worry that internal tubing gets clogged with coffee oils and scale quickly, leading to bad-tasting coffee or expensive repairs.
The Reality: Maintenance on the Vertuo Pop+ Deluxe is remarkably straightforward. Used capsules are automatically ejected into an internal container once you twist the lever open, holding up to 8 large pods before needing disposal. Descaling alerts light up automatically after a set number of brews, and running a cleaning cycle takes less than 10 minutes using standard Nespresso descaling solution.
